Dedicated Full-Stack Developer with 5+ years of experience building robust and scalable web applications using Node.js and React.js. Proven track record in designing, developing, and deploying efficient solutions that meet stringent business requirements. Skilled in leveraging modern JavaScript frameworks and libraries, along with cloud platforms and DevOps practices, to deliver high-quality products.
Project list
E-Payment
Create service for payment gateway to connect HSBC to payment transaction
Using pure Vuejs to create the form to help users be able to enter their contract number to get payment information and using Vuex to store information.
Using HTML/CSS pure to build form and validation through Vuejs validation provider.
Using Axios to create a http client to call API to get payment information, and also using SocketIO to update payment status when users scan and pay successfully
Create service for helping users which want to booking container from ONE provider, build up the web application for user able to get information from Port Pair which containers available for booking, draft price and contract for user have a look whole process booking easier before they decide to book container.
create the SearchQuote step to help users look up quotations followed by port pair they picked, also create vessel-date calendar to manipulate price which vesse available on calendar, which user can choose and navigate to next step which information summarization. For State Management, I'm using react hook useReducer to store information from the FE side and manipulated by several react hook methods.
Using React-hook form to validate and create the form.
Using React-query to caching data vessels from the port pair which the users selected. Using Reacthook useReducer to store information on vessels available and price for vessel date.
create an API query port pair to respond to several schedules available and price on the vessel date calendar
Create web application for helping users interactive events meeting on their own calendar, sync up with GG calendar by use their API references, sync up with Outlook with M$ Api References.
Using Redux to store and manipulate schedule meetings and React Hook method to generate calendar available for the next steps.
Using React-hook form to validate information which user entry (date, time, link meeting...).
Using Axios to create http client to calling API generate available schedule for initial page which users are able to select quick view and set meeting link for it through API update schedule
Create web application for helping users create campaign metric and cohort user groups following criteria with data from big query GCP, also implement methods to tracking the campaign result from user who have booking contract.
Creating the cohort page which includes Cohort Creation which.
Using Reacthook useReducer to store and manipulate information followed by mapping content to generate algorithm json mapping, helps the backend module take json mapping generate SQL query to return back which list cohort matching with condition when user want to query.
Using React-hook form to validate and create the form helping users to enter data conditions which they want.
Using Axios to setup http client to create and get information cohort from the form. Using React-query to caching data which user gets information cohort and list cohort which api is already calling and mutation to calling api update cohort information for user.
create API get list cohort following by condition which FE request, create API searching following list cohorts which user get in the table (pagination, search by name, cohort...)
A GPS navigation app that help drivers get driving directions, live traffic map and road alert.
Creating web apps using redux to store locations and driver information when users access the page.
Admin-dashboard: manipulated information which drivers share to get direction suggestions back to drivers and traffic at that location as well through API.
Using redux to store user login state.
Using Antd design to generate component UI.
Using Axios to get information from driver and location traffic as well.
Technologies: React, AWS, Redux
Title Logistic
The website to sell and control the price of real estate.
Create Admin-dashboard manipulated information which drivers share to get direction suggestions back to drivers and traffic at that location as well through API,
Creating web apps using redux to store locations and driver information when users access the page.
Team makes it easy to lock cryptocurrency founder tokens and DEX liquidity tokens.
Creating the UI search form which helps users be able to search their contract through UI interaction, using redux to store contracts which the user is already searching, to help users don't have to call API again which contracts they already searched before. Using Axios to call the api get contract information with the corresponding parameters.
Technologies: React, AWS, Redux
Veretis-strong
The web application for helping doctors create patient regimens for treatment, as well as allowing patients to book their own doctors and treatment through their own premade course exercises.
Designing and developing the frontend and backend components of the application using Node.js, React.js, and associated technologies.
Creating a secure and user-friendly platform for doctors to create personalized patient regimens, including treatment plans, medication schedules, and exercise recommendations.
Implementing a patient portal that allows patients to easily book appointments, access their medical records, and complete prescribed exercises.
Akasic App is the Messenger of The New Blockchain Era which enables you to join a variety of blockchain communities, including the active and thriving community of Masternet project.
Creating UI base on figma UI related to communication module like chatting, user-guide line.
Kitchen Pals is the unique kitchen app that will change how you cook and shop.
Integrating third-party APIs and services to provide additional functionalities, such as ingredient pricing and nutrition information.
Optimizing the app's performance and scalability to handle a growing user base.
Conducting thorough testing and quality assurance to identify and resolve bugs before deployment.
Maintaining and updating the app to address user feedback and evolving trends in the kitchen app market.
Technologies: PHP, Laravel
Price observatory official
Scrape data from website to fill information into our website for support marketing work.
Create SQL statement to connect db with query by condition with user required to collect information from goods. By the way, I'm investigating competitor websites to crawl prices from their goods to provide users with better prices and make the comparison.
Technologies: PHP
Boobytrap
Boobytrapp is a social mobile app that helps connect breast cancer patients.
I'm responsible for creating mobile apps the form initial when users create their account to login the system.
Manage information which user provider when they enter value into the form and call api to update and create an account for the user.